asdf
This commit is contained in:
@@ -33,10 +33,10 @@ alias do_sync='rsync -rvltDhu --delete --partial --progress'
|
||||
|
||||
################### GLOBAL FUNCTIONS #########################
|
||||
msg() {
|
||||
printf '[*] %s\n' "$*"
|
||||
printf '\n[*] %s\n\n' "$*"
|
||||
}
|
||||
errmsg() {
|
||||
>&2 printf '[Error]: %s\n' "$*"
|
||||
>&2 printf '\n[Error]: %s\n\n' "$*"
|
||||
}
|
||||
die() {
|
||||
errmsg "$*"
|
||||
|
||||
@@ -66,9 +66,7 @@ fi
|
||||
# 05. Begin functions
|
||||
# ===================================================
|
||||
update_server() {
|
||||
echo
|
||||
msg "============== UPDATING DAYZ SERVER ================="
|
||||
echo
|
||||
steamcmd -tcp \
|
||||
+force_install_dir "$LOCAL_STOCK_SERVER" \
|
||||
+@sSteamCmdForcePlatformType windows \
|
||||
@@ -79,15 +77,11 @@ update_server() {
|
||||
|
||||
is_network_drive_mounted &&
|
||||
do_sync "$LOCAL_STOCK_SERVER"/ "$REMOTE_STOCK_SERVER"
|
||||
echo
|
||||
msg "============ DONE UPDATING SERVER ====================="
|
||||
echo
|
||||
}
|
||||
|
||||
update_game() {
|
||||
echo
|
||||
msg "========== UPDATING DAYZ GAME ================"
|
||||
echo
|
||||
steamcmd -tcp \
|
||||
+force_install_dir "$LOCAL_STOCK_GAME" \
|
||||
+@sSteamCmdForcePlatformType windows \
|
||||
@@ -98,16 +92,12 @@ update_game() {
|
||||
|
||||
is_network_drive_mounted &&
|
||||
do_sync "$LOCAL_STOCK_GAME"/ "$REMOTE_STOCK_GAME"
|
||||
echo
|
||||
msg "============= DONE UPDATING GAME ==================="
|
||||
echo
|
||||
}
|
||||
|
||||
# args: $1 = server_modlist.txt to update
|
||||
update_mods_for_server() {
|
||||
echo
|
||||
msg "======= UPDATING MODS FOR: $1 ========"
|
||||
echo
|
||||
|
||||
mods_file="$MODLISTS/$1"
|
||||
map_name=${1%.txt}
|
||||
@@ -159,9 +149,7 @@ update_mods_for_server() {
|
||||
die "Problem downloading mods for $map_name"
|
||||
fi
|
||||
|
||||
echo
|
||||
msg "------------ RENAMING MODS -------------"
|
||||
echo
|
||||
mods_to_copy="$LOCAL_MODS/mods_to_copy"
|
||||
rm -rf "$mods_to_copy" 2>/dev/null ||:
|
||||
mkdir -p "$mods_to_copy"
|
||||
@@ -183,17 +171,13 @@ update_mods_for_server() {
|
||||
esac
|
||||
done < "$mods_file"
|
||||
|
||||
echo
|
||||
msg "----------- SYNCING MODS -------------"
|
||||
echo
|
||||
do_sync "$mods_to_copy"/ "$REMOTE_MODS"
|
||||
|
||||
rm -f "$tempfile" 2>/dev/null ||:
|
||||
unset tempfile mod map_name mods_file mods_to_copy mod_name mod_id
|
||||
|
||||
echo
|
||||
msg "======= DONE UPDATING MODS FOR: $1 ========"
|
||||
echo
|
||||
}
|
||||
|
||||
update_stock_maps() {
|
||||
|
||||
Reference in New Issue
Block a user